Netflix's new true crime spoof, "American Vandal" is your new favorite thing

Netflix has a new 8-part series American Vandal, and it's now our new obsession. The series is a spoof of the true crime shows that the streaming giant helped make famous, taking a Making A Murderer approach to the show. A half-hour satire about the aftermath of a high school prank that left twenty-seven faculty cars vandalized with phallic images. The main suspect is Dylan Maxwell, a senior and known dick-drawer, who gets expelled after the incident. Then, an aspiring sophomore documentary film maker suggests that Dylan is not guilty and starts to uncover truth to the show's biggest question... Who Drew The Dicks?

American Vandal was co-created by Tony Yacenda (Pillow Talking) and Dan Perrault (Honest Trailers), and showrunner Dan Lagana (Zach Stone Is Gonna Be Famous).
